JOB SUMMARY

The Cost Accountant is responsible for analyzing, tracking, and reporting costs related to company operations, including manufacturing, procurement, and project activities. This role supports accurate financial reporting, assists with budgeting and forecasting, and ensures proper cost allocation across departments and projects.


The ideal candidate will have experience in accounting or bookkeeping - preferably in the chemical manufacturing industry - with a solid understanding of job costing, accounts payable, and invoicing. This position collaborates with suppliers, internal stakeholders, and regulatory bodies to maintain compliance with statutory requirements and all internal UBE standards and procedures.

Requirements

ACCOUNTS PAYABLE R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Match purchase orders, receipts, and invoices and resolve discrepancies with procurement or operations.
  • Verify invoices, enter them into the accounting system, and ensure proper cost.
  • Manage payments based on invoice due dates.
  • Reconcile bank statements and vendor accounts.
  • Maintain organized records of financial transactions, contracts, and vendor files.

COST ANALYSIS R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Analyze manufacturing costs by tracking material, labor, and overhead expenses, and ensure accurate cost allocation to products and work orders.
  • Summarize cost trends and variances and prepare monthly cost reports for management.
  • Monitor inventory transactions, reconcile balances, review adjustments, and ensure accurate valuation.
  • Provide cost data and analysis to support financial planning, budgeting, and forecasting.
  • Assist with monthly financial reports and manufacturing cost analysis.
  • Perform other general administrative and accounting tasks as needed.
